Sitters on Rover are free to set their rates. The median cost to hire a sitter for doggy day care in Oregon Hill on Rover as of Feb 2026 was about $30 per day, after factoring in Roverâs service fees. A sitterâs rate may also change as you customize your booking to fit your and your dogâs needs.
As of Feb 2026, 143 sitters provided doggy day care in Oregon Hill. You can filter, sort, expand your radius, read reviews, and compare pricing to find the perfect sitter near you. As a reminder, sitters offering doggy day care joining Rover must pass a background check for you and your dogâs safety.
Rover makes it easy to reach out to multiple sitters about your booking. Typically, 89% of Oregon Hill sitters offering doggy day care respond in under an hour.
Sitters who provide doggy day care in Oregon Hill have an average of 19 years of experience. Sitters offering doggy day care with repeat customers have an average of 3 repeat clients. Drop off your dog at the sitterâs home and rest easy knowing theyâll get frequent potty breaks, plenty of playtime, and lots of love. Doggy day care is great for:
- Puppies and high-energy dogs
- Dogs with special needs, including seniors
- Pet parents who work long hours
- Dogs with separation anxiety
There are 143 sitters offering doggy day care in Oregon Hill on Rover, so youâre sure to find the perfect match for your dog! In Oregon Hill, 100% of sitters offer daily exercise, 100% offer medication administration, and 87% have experience with senior dogs and dogs with special needs.
